#4b42b4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4b42b4 is composed of 29.4% red, 25.9% green and 70.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 58.3% cyan, 63.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 29.4% black. It has a hue angle of 244.7 degrees, a saturation of 46.3% and a lightness of 48.2%. #4b42b4 color hex could be obtained by blending #9684ff with #000069. Closest websafe color is: #3333cc.

#4b42b4 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4b42b4 has RGB values of R:75, G:66, B:180 and CMYK values of C:0.58, M:0.63, Y:0, K:0.29. Its decimal value is 4932276.

Shades and Tints of #4b42b4
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030308 is the darkest color, while #f9f8fd is the lightest one.
